    KBB Scholars Application




    In the spirit of the first graduating class comprised of three women — Sophia Keyes, Mary Barber, and Sara Benedict, The University of Olivet offers students a scholarship and leadership development opportunities.

    KBB Scholars Program – The University of Olivet

    Since its founding, The University of Olivet has been committed to educating and advancing leaders from all backgrounds. The Keyes-Barber-Benedict (KBB) Scholars Program brings that mission to life—a leadership development experience built around student-led growth.

    Start as a KBB Pioneer

    Every participant begins as a KBB Pioneer member. As a Pioneer, you'll learn what it means to be on a team—from following effectively to leading as part of an executive board. You'll collaborate with other student organizations, create cross-disciplinary activities, and help fellow students find belonging across majors and departments. You'll also learn to align with a shared mission and pass those values on to the next generation.

    Through active listening, self-awareness, and emotional intelligence, you'll become a calm, grounded, and centered leader. As a Pioneer, you're always leading—and growing from the inside out.

    Become a KBB Scholar

    KBB Scholars are Pioneers who are accepted into the scholarship program. To apply, you'll submit:

    • An essay about your leadership experience and ambitions

    • A letter of recommendation

    • A current resume

    Once accepted, you'll receive a financial award and an unmatched opportunity to grow as a leader and team player. Your commitment and attendance are tracked each semester to support your success in the program.

    Ongoing Requirements for KBB Scholars

    To maintain your scholarship and active membership each semester, you'll need to:

    • Communicate proactively with the leadership team about your participation and availability

    • Excel academically with a cumulative GPA of 3.0 or higher

    • Grow as a leader by attending at least two workshops per semester

    • Serve your community through at least one volunteer event per semester (civic engagement)

    • Build career readiness with one activity per semester (workshop, career exploration event, resume review, etc.)

    • Share your journey with a year-end capstone presentation on your leadership growth

    Open to All

    The KBB Scholars Program is open to all students, regardless of gender, gender identity, or gender non-conforming identities. Any student interested in developing leadership skills will benefit—whether you start as a Pioneer or go on to become a KBB Scholar.

    KBB Scholars have access to:
    • A KBB Scholarship – Amount varies based on your Financial Aid determination.

    • Leadership team roles – Serve on the KBB Executive Board and lead the KBB organization.

    • The Leadership Learning Community – Where you'll connect with premier leaders and alumni from diverse backgrounds, career fields, and experiences.

    • Experiential learning opportunities – Including internships, job shadowing, leadership retreats, conferences, and more.

    Eligibility & Application Process:
    • New first-year or transfer students (new to The University of Olivet) may apply directly for the KBB Scholarship.

    • Current students must first participate as KBB Pioneer members, demonstrate their commitment, and then apply for the KBB Scholarship in the following semester.

    • All applicants must have a minimum cumulative GPA of 3.0 on a 4.0 scale.

    • Online students are not eligible for the KBB Scholarship, as their tuition already reflects a discounted rate.

    • Applications received by February 1st will be given priority consideration.
